This summer, June 29 - July 23, at the Contemporary Space of Athens (a place created in Greece by the Chicago Athenaeum Museum for Architecture and Design in collaboration with the European Centre for Architecture, Design and Urban Studies) people from Athens had the chance to see more than 150 works of art by 38 Greek designers, who met and joined their forces for their first time.

The event was organised by the famous Chicago Athenaeum Museum of Architecture and Design in collaboration with Good Design Awards. The awards, the oldest institution about design globally, were established in 1950 and they have been indispensable part of the programme of the New York Museum of Modern Art (MoMA). Almost seven decades later after their establishment the organisation of Good Design Awards, joined by the Chicago Athenaeum Museum for Architecture and Design, is trying to keep this spirit alive all over the world by demonstrating the design excellence. The annual museum programme includes exhibitions in various central places, both in Europe and the USA.

This year, in Good Design Greece Exhibition 2017, the categories were the following: Industrial Design, Textile Design, Environmental / Interior Design, Furniture Design, Graphic Design / Packaging. Pitsilkas hand-made luxury furniture collection was exhibited for the first time in Greece. The quality of materials along with the strict design criteria and perfect manufacturing were the furniture features praised by visitors, who were particularly impressed.
